Considerations: Weighing the Factors

While body mists can offer potential benefits, it’s crucial to consider a few factors before embracing this practice:

1. Alcohol Content: Many body mists contain alcohol, which can be drying to hair. Excessive use of alcohol-based body mists on hair may lead to dryness and damage.
2. Sensitivity: If you have sensitive skin or a sensitive scalp, applying body mist to your hair may cause irritation. It’s advisable to test a small amount on an inconspicuous area before applying it to your entire head of hair.
3. Product Compatibility: Not all body mists are formulated for use on hair. Some products may contain ingredients that are not suitable for hair application. Always read the product label carefully before using any body mist on your hair.

Additional Tips for Optimal Results

1. Spray from a Distance: Hold the body mist about 6-8 inches away from your hair to avoid over-spraying and potential damage.
2. Focus on the Ends: Apply the body mist primarily to the ends of your hair, as they tend to be drier and more prone to damage.
3. Avoid Roots: Steer clear of spraying the body mist directly onto your roots, as this can weigh down your hair and make it appear greasy.
4. Use Sparingly: A little goes a long way. Apply the body mist sparingly to avoid overpowering your hair with fragrance or causing dryness.

FAQs: Addressing Your Queries

1. Can I apply body mist to wet hair?

  • Yes, you can apply body mist to wet hair. However, it’s important to towel dry your hair first to remove excess water.

2. Will body mist damage my hair?

  • Excessive use of alcohol-based body mists can potentially damage your hair. Opt for body mists with minimal alcohol content and avoid applying them to dry or damaged hair.

3. Can I use body mist as a hairspray?

  • Body mists are not formulated to provide the same hold as hairspray. They may offer a light hold, but they are not a substitute for traditional hairspray.

4. Can I apply body mist to my scalp?

  • It’s generally not recommended to apply body mist directly to your scalp. Some body mists may contain ingredients that can irritate the scalp.

5. How often can I apply body mist to my hair?

  • The frequency of application depends on your hair type and needs. If you have dry hair, you may apply body mist once or twice a day. If you have oily hair, limit the application to once or twice a week.
